A great camera
Review of Sony Handycam DCR SR30E by
FrancescaTimbers
Advantages: slim, waterproof camera and offers antishake
Disadvantages: Sound not of great quality
This small handy digital camcorder is a point-and-shoot model offering a number of great technologies such as Green/blue screen, Stabilization, light capture technology and touchscreen editing as well as a powerful zoom in/out, All-Weather body design. Sometimes water and photography are a bad combination, limiting outdoor photography options when rain, snow or sleet are involved. However, this digital camcorder can go virtually anywhere. The aluminium ... ...be held in one hand during recording without the picture going jagged. Battery life also extremly long and battery is lightweight so spares can easily be transported along with the camera if you require. Sound quality not quite up to the same superior quality of the picture, and can be slightly echoed/fuzzy/disorted but all together a great camera! Would reccomend. ...

Sexy and Functional
Review of Sony Handycam DCR TRV270 by
smooth_criminal_
Advantages: Great audio and visual quality, affordable, lots of features, brilliant zoom
Disadvantages: Not for the seasoned professional
The Sony Handycam DCR TRV270, a Digital8 model (a combination of the Hi8 analogue tape and the digital codec), achieves a perfect balance between high quality and affordability. Not only is this superb video-camera highly functional, boasting an impressive array of different features, its sleek and sexy look makes it a unique and attractive choice. While it is by no means a suitable option for the seasoned professional, it is ideal for the amateur ... ...you would expect from a Sony - polished, compact, and attractive. The various buttons are well situated, with the record and power buttons conveniently placed, and the buttons providing access to the more adventurous features either on the back or neatly positioned behind the LCD display where they cannot get in the way.
